It may sound surprising, but Libya is the country to visit in order to see the Sahara Desert in its entire splendor. Ever since Colonel Qaddafi surprised the world announcing that Libya would give up its weapons programs, it has become one of the most politically stable countries in the region and thus an ideal place to travel to in order to see the wonders of the desert.
